Category: 1099-Misc Box 3 Reporting
1099-Misc Box 3 Reporting refers to Box 3 on Form 1099‑MISC, which is labeled Other Income and is used to report payments that do not fit into the form’s other specific boxes. Settlement administrators and defendants sometimes report the entire gross payment in Box 3 (and sometimes also issue a 1099 to the plaintiff’s attorney or IOLTA). That practice can create confusion and apparent “double reporting,” but it’s often driven by conservative reporting practices and the payer’s lack of certainty about tax character.
